Secret Factors to Consider Before Clicking "Add to Cart"
Shopping for a treadmill online suggests one can not test the maker personally before acquiring. For that reason, buyers need to count on specifications, measurements, and research. Here are the most crucial elements to evaluate:
1. Motor Power (CHP)
Continuous Horsepower (CHP) measures the power output of the motor over a sustained duration. The suitable CHP depends entirely on the user's main activity:
- Walking: 2.0 to 2.5 CHP suffices.
- Running: 2.5 to 3.0 CHP is suggested.
- Running/Heavy Use: 3.0 CHP or higher is necessary to manage intense, daily workouts.
2. Belt Size
The dimensions of the running surface area dictate comfort and safety.
- Height under 5'8": A 45-to-50-inch long belt might be enough for strolling.
- Average to Tall Runners: A minimum length of 55 to 60 inches and a width of 20 inches is ideal to accommodate a natural stride without the risk of stepping off the edge.
3. Weight Capacity
Always inspect the maximum user weight limit. As a guideline of thumb, it is wise to select a treadmill with a weight capacity at least 50 pounds heavier than the heaviest desired user. This makes sure structural stability and lowers motor pressure.
4. Folding vs. Non-Folding
Area is often the choosing consider home gym style. Folding treadmills feature hydraulic systems that permit the deck to raise vertically when not in use. Non-folding models (often discovered in industrial settings) provide remarkable stability and a stronger feel, but they require a permanent footprint.

Purchasing a large, expensive item online requires a bit of method. Keep these ideas in mind to guarantee a smooth deal:
- Measure Twice, Buy Once: Measure the designated workout area, keeping ceiling height in mind (particularly if the cheap treadmill has an incline). Do not forget to determine entrances, corridors, and stairwells to ensure the boxed device can in fact enter the space.
- Understand the Warranty: A quality treadmill need to feature a strong guarantee. Search for life time protection on the frame and motor, a minimum of 1 to 3 years on parts, and 1 year on labor.
- Inspect Return Policies: Treadmills are notoriously tough to return due to their size and weight. Constantly read the merchant's return policy carefully, noting whether you are accountable for return shipping fees or a restocking cost.
- Purchase Professional Assembly: Many online merchants provide "White Glove Delivery," where a group brings the treadmill within, assembles it in your space of option, and transports away the product packaging. Given the intricacy of contemporary treadmills, this add-on is often well worth the expense.

3. How much area do I need around a treadmill?
For security factors, manufacturers usually advise leaving a minimum of 6 to 8 feet of clearance behind the treadmill and 2 feet of clearance on both sides. This guarantees that if you slip or fall, you have a safe buffer zone.
4. What maintenance does an online-bought treadmill require?
A lot of home treadmills need standard regular upkeep to extend their life expectancy. This includes:
- Regularly cleaning down sweat to prevent rust.
- Vacuuming dust below the belt.
- Lubricating the strolling belt every 3 to 6 months with silicone-based lube.
